Đang Thực Hiện

Bash admin gui rewrite in perl or bash and modify functionality

I have a web based GUI of a network equipment management application. It runs on a Redhat Linux server as apache CGI. It is written in bash and basically it is all about issuing snmp queries in the end and presenting the results in the browser and as CSV files.

Currently the code is undocumented and very much spaghetti like. It also mixes html code with business logic.

The tasks are:

-rewrite the code preferably in perl or if no other option in bash (nothing else can be used. no php, python .net etc)

-make the queries asynchronous so as the browser would not have to wait for the snmp queries to run (separate a worker process and implement some basic job control mechanism). Some of the queries can be run by any user, some others need authentication.

I have 20+ different SNMP queries to be rewritten, although I would like to have a maintainable framework for:

-hooking up any number of queries by adding some config to the gui and/or the worker

-add equipment to manage in config file

This current work is about to test your idea on 1 query and create the framework parts where all others can be hooked upon and configure it to run that 1 query.

To award this work, I need to hear your plan to:

-which language to use perl or bash

-how would you extract html code from the current codebase (a templating solution would be preferable)

-how would you separate the worker from the gui

-other details on the application framework to be created

-references to something similar scripting or perl work

I can send code examples on request. I attach a ppt with a structural drawing of the current application.

Kĩ năng: Linux, Perl, Kiến trúc phần mềm, Quản trị hệ thống

Xem nhiều hơn: python web framework, ppt architecture, php scripting business, php admin framework, parts of a business plan, job in drawing, gui test plan, gui number, software write edid, free software write company profile, software write websites idea, software write book images, software write books, software write protection, free software write book, software write book, software write protect software, software write technical manual

Về Bên Thuê:
( 1 Nhận xét ) Erdokurt, Hungary

ID dự án: #9605577

15 freelancer chào giá trung bình€541 cho công việc này

vili1977

Hello. I have experience with perl and web gui for perl. Can you explain do you want to see statistics or manage some device via snmp? Please read my feedbacks. Thank you.

€333 EUR trong 5 ngày
(810 Nhận xét)
7.4
MacJeremy

To whom it may concern, I have 15+ years of *nix experience. For the past 8 years I have been building, administering, hardening, optimizing and maintaining servers based on LFS. I have also experience in Ubuntu, De Thêm

€452 EUR trong 7 ngày
(10 Nhận xét)
6.2
anuyadav1

i can write it in perl .

€500 EUR trong 5 ngày
(47 Nhận xét)
5.7
PerlIsFun

There are lots of unknowns here, but one thing is clear: Perl, full time. Whereas I do have experience with HTML::Template, HTML::Mason, HTML::Embperl and Template Toolkit for the templating part, it's already a few Thêm

€750 EUR trong 30 ngày
(40 Nhận xét)
5.5
alexstech

Please see inline my plan for this project, -which language to use perl or bash PERL -how would you extract html code from the current codebase (a templating solution would be preferable) I would like to see a samp Thêm

€444 EUR trong 7 ngày
(3 Nhận xét)
3.6
€555 EUR trong 7 ngày
(6 Nhận xét)
3.1
fixfin

We are CRM, ERP, POS, Custom Software solution providing company. We also deal with Portal, Blog, Social Media, e-commerce solution, Linux Migration and Open Source Development. We are quite confident that we can accom Thêm

€333 EUR trong 15 ngày
(2 Nhận xét)
2.2
hasanucak

hi. i worked on Network Monitoring system via Zenoss open source project. it trace all process on Linux servers more than hunderd with snmp querries. i write extension via perl,bash,php at Zenoss Server. i can do y Thêm

€555 EUR trong 10 ngày
(1 Nhận xét)
2.2
€555 EUR trong 10 ngày
(1 Nhận xét)
1.7
jlpvw

-which language to use perl or bash Perl would definitely be the language of choice for this. Suitable SNMP libraries already exist for Perl and I have experience using them. -how would you extract html code fro Thêm

€444 EUR trong 10 ngày
(0 Nhận xét)
0.0
N0laan

Hello, I'm an 7 years experienced perl developer. I've successfully completed projects from small one to larger ones. To solve do your project I plan to use the Catalyst MVC framework which separate the Data, Present Thêm

€533 EUR trong 4 ngày
(0 Nhận xét)
0.0
blu3g3

A proposal has not yet been provided

€777 EUR trong 4 ngày
(0 Nhận xét)
0.0
brandon0

Good morning, I've built several projects like this in the past. Working with Networking gear can be entertaining at times, and down right frustrating in others. What I would like to do for you is the following: Thêm

€777 EUR trong 10 ngày
(0 Nhận xét)
0.0
dasgagarin

I have 5+ years of experience with this kind of project...

€555 EUR trong 45 ngày
(0 Nhận xét)
0.0
kaiorafael

I have strong Bash Scripting background, you can check my Bash Projects profile at: [login to view URL] [login to view URL] Perl source code: https://bitbu Thêm

€555 EUR trong 20 ngày
(0 Nhận xét)
0.0